Heap

Heap noun - A considerable amount.
Usage example: you're in a heap of trouble for missing curfew!

Sheaf is a synonym for heap. In some cases you can use "Sheaf" instead a noun "Heap".

Sheaf

Sheaf noun - A considerable amount.
Usage example: contends that casino gambling would generate a sheaf of social problems for the state

Heap is a synonym for sheaf in bundle topic. You can use "Heap" instead a noun "Sheaf", if it concerns topics such as pile, collection of something.
